Computer vision, a subfield of artificial intelligence, is revolutionizing flaw detection across various industries by automating and enhancing the accuracy of inspecting products. Traditionally reliant on manual inspection, which was often inconsistent and not scalable, flaw detection now benefits from computer vision's ability to quickly process large datasets, reducing inspection times and human error. This technology is particularly impactful in sectors like manufacturing, automotive, and electronics, where it helps identify and classify defects such as surface scratches, structural issues, and material inconsistencies, ensuring products meet quality and safety standards. The use of pre-trained models, like those available on platforms such as Roboflow Universe, allows industries to deploy specialized object detection for real-time monitoring, leading to cost savings, increased efficiency, and improved quality control. By integrating these systems into automated processes, companies can promptly address defects, minimizing waste and enhancing overall productivity.
